#3. Braun Strowman - A former ally of Drew McIntyre

Drew McIntyre and Braun Strowman were allies for a very brief period in 2018. It was during The Shield's reunion phases where Braun Strowman aligned with Drew McIntyre and his then-tag team partner Dolph Ziggler.

That alliance didn't last for long, as RAW needed a babyface once Roman Reigns was out of action due to leukemia. The alliance led to Braun Strowman's brief heel run ending after Drew McIntyre accidentally hit him with a Claymore Kick.

There are few superstars who WWE has dropped with more than Braun Strowman, and even his 2020 Universal Championship run was purely circumstantial, as Roman Reigns pulled out from WrestleMania 36.

At 37 years of age, Braun Strowman still has a lot of mileage left in WWE. He could always become the face of RAW once crowds return, but only if he is booked well. His booking between 2017 and 2018 was proof that he was on track to becoming the hottest superstar in the company.

He has the presence to be the face of RAW, even if it's not a long-term solution.
